Conditions

Embedded and impacted teeth. An impacted tooth is a tooth that has failed to erupt because of obstruction by another tooth.

Interventions

Intervention 1: Intervention group :chlordiazepoxide, (10 mg). Intervention 2: Intervention group :(10 mg) oxazepam tablet. Intervention 3: control group received a capsule containing vitamin C with
Treatment - Drugs
Intervention group :chlordiazepoxide, (10 mg)
Intervention group :(10 mg) oxazepam tablet.
control group received a capsule containing vitamin C with a glass of orange juice as placebo.

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
Success rate of anesthesia. Timepoint: 5, 15 and 30 min. Method of measurement: electric pulp tester.

Secondary

MeasureTime frame
Pian level. Timepoint: During the injection. Method of measurement: visual analog scale.
